Late-night host Seth Meyers recently shared insights into the early skepticism surrounding his skills as an interviewer. He revealed that both he and others questioned his capabilities after his successful run on 'Weekend Update.' Meyers has since established a strong reputation for his interview style.

Context

Seth Meyers gained prominence as a writer and anchor on 'Saturday Night Live's' 'Weekend Update.' Despite his success, he faced initial doubts about his ability to conduct interviews effectively. Over time, he has developed a distinctive interviewing style that has contributed to his popularity as a late-night host.
